i count ~29 combo's hitting the river ace for pj and 24 being 88-JJ. i'm assuming he has a few non-pair hands like K9-KJfd, JTfd. around half of his range hits the river ace. i would think if you were betting the river for value, it would be mainly with two-pairs and sets (~20 combos, around 13% of your range). idk but maybe you're supposed to bet some qx hands (~55 total) to balance out the airball hands you have (~11 missed non-pair fd's) or just bluff a lot less. if you include qx hands as bluff catchers, 78% of our range on the river are bluff catchers, which leads me to think checking our whole range is a lot easier to balance. i assume much of my thinking is flawed in some way.

So I started using this problem as motivation to start coding up a GTO solver.
Are people interested in discussing this? Using the ranges above I sorted by river hand value and then parameterized the strategy space by using regions of hand values for specific action lines. The a_i's are used to parameterize Jesse's range, b_i's to parameterize Joker's range if Jesse Bets, and c_i's for Joker's range if Jesse checks. As shown I'm assuming a 3-bet cap. K means check, R means raise, E means 3-bet.
Do these sequences of action lines look reasonable?
Code:
[a0,a1) KRF bluff [b0,b1) F [c0,c1) BF bluff
[a1,a2) KF [b1,b2) RF bluff [c1,c2) K
[a2,a3) KC [b2,b3) C [c2,c3) BF
[a3,a4) BF [b3,b4) RF [c3,c4) BC
[a4,a5) BC [b4,b5) RC [c4,c5) BE
[a5,a6) KRC
[a6,a7) BE
